While the Lovely Wishes Timed Research may be the centerpiece ofPokemon GO’s Valentine’s Day event, there are also some event-exclusive Field Research tasks available. As per usual, these tasks are obtained by spinning PokeStops, and each one awards a Pokemon encounter upon completion. This guide is here to provide more details on those encounters, and it will help players decide which of the Valentine’s Day event Field Research tasks inPokemon GOare worth pursuing.

To note, several of the Pokemon that can be encountered through the completion ofPoGO’s Valentine’s Day eventField Research tasks award bonus Stardust when caught. Specifically, Combee grants 750 Stardust per catch, Morelull grants 500 Stardust per catch, and Audino grants a whooping 2,100 Stardust per catch. Players are thus advised to always complete the “spin 10 PokeStops or Gyms” and “open 5 Gifts” tasks, and it is wise to leave the awarded Pokemon uncaught until an event with a Stardust multiplier is underway.
For the sake of full clarity, a few words about leaving Field Research encounters unclaimed may be pertinent. Quite simply, it is possible to have up to 100 encounters “stacked” within the “Claim Reward” button in the Field section, though there is no in-game indication of how many encounters are available to be claimed. To perform this “stacking,“Pokemon GOplayersshould simply complete a Field Research task, initiate its Pokemon encounter, and then run away by pressing the icon near the top-left corner of the screen.
With respect to when players should complete the Audino, Combee, and Morelull encounters that they stack, the Woobat Spotlight Hour is the next event with a Stardust multiplier. That event will occur on Tuesday, February 14 from 6 to 7pm local time, and a double Catch Stardust bonus will be in effect. This means that every Audino that is caught during the event will award 4,200 Stardust, and players can push those gains even higher by using aStar Piece inPoGO.
